If you know anything about herbal treatments for treating benign prostatic hypertrophy (enlarged prostate) in men, there are good chances you have heard about Saw Palmetto.

While saw palmetto has proved to be effective in hair loss and this herb has been analyzed and studied well, there are notable side effects for women like gastrointestinal problems, menstrual irregularities.
